2020-08-24ARM: OMAP2+: Drop legacy platform data for am3 and am4 rtcTony Lindgren
We can now probe devices with ti-sysc interconnect driver and dts data. Let's drop the related platform data and custom ti,hwmods dts property. As we're just dropping data, and the early platform data init is based on the custom ti,hwmods property, we want to drop both the platform data and ti,hwmods property in a single patch. Note that we also must tag rtc as disabled on am43x-epos-evm as it's not accessible according to commit 4321dc8dff35 ("ARM: AM43XX: hwmod: Add rtc hwmod"). And we must keep RTC enabled for rtcwake to work now that we've removed the custom platfor code for re-enabling the RTC on suspend. 2020-05-19ARM: dts: Configure system timers for am437xTony Lindgren
We can now init system timers using the dmtimer and 32k counter based on only devicetree data and drivers/clocksource timers. Let's configure the clocksource and clockevent, and drop the old unused platform data. As we're just dropping platform data, and the early platform data init is based on the custom ti,hwmods property, we want to drop both the platform data and ti,hwmods property in a single patch. Since the dmtimer can use both 32k clock and system clock as the source, let's also configure the SoC specific default values. The board specific dts files can reconfigure these with assigned-clocks and assigned-clock-parents as needed. 2017-09-19ARM: OMAP2+: Fix MMC address space mismatch for am33xx and am43xxTony Lindgren
The address space currently set up for the interconnect data is different compared to the dts data. We have hwmod data with offset 0x100 to account for the revision, sysc and syss register offsets. Let's fix the issue by correcting the MMC register offsets in hwmod data and removing the unnecessary duplicate IO range data that we get from device tree anyways. 2016-06-10ARM: AM335x/AM437x: hwmod: Remove eQEP, ePWM and eCAP hwmod entriesFranklin S Cooper Jr
Devices that utilize the OCP registers and/or PRCM registers and register bit fields should be modeled using hwmod. Since eQEP, ePWM and eCAP don't fall under this category, remove their hwmod entries. Instead these clocks simply use the clock that is passed through by its parent PWMSS. Therefore, PWMSS handles the clock for itself and its subdevices. 2013-10-13ARM: OMAP2+: hwmod: AM335x/AM43x: move common dataAfzal Mohammed
AM335x and AM43x have most of the IP's and interconnect's similar. Instead of adding redundant hwmod data, move interconnects and hwmod similar between AM335x and AM43x to a common location. This helps in reuse on AM43x. AM335x interconnects that has difference and not present in AM43x are not moved. ocp clock of those in l4_wkup is fed from a different source for AM43x. Also pruss interconnect is different. AM335x hwmod's that has difference other than prcm register offsets (difference is in clocks of wkup_m3, control, gpio0, debugss and clock domain of l4_hs, adc_tsc as compared to AM43x) and those that are not present in AM43x are not moved.
